## VSCode 整理代码: 轻松告别凌乱代码### 简介代码整洁是优秀程序员的基本素养。整洁的代码不仅赏心悦目,更能提升代码可读性和可维护性,减少潜在 bug。而 VSCode 作为一个强大的代码编辑器,提供了丰富的代码整理功能,帮助我们轻松告别凌乱代码,提高开发效率。### VSCode 代码整理功能VSCode 提供了多种方式来整理代码,主要包括以下几种:#### 1. 格式化文档 (Format Document)
功能:
根据预设的代码风格规范自动格式化整个文档。
操作:
快捷键: `Shift + Alt + F` (Windows) 或 `Shift + Option + F` (macOS)
菜单栏: `选择 / 代码 / 格式化文档`
右键菜单: `格式化文档`
配置:
格式化样式可以通过设置进行个性化配置,例如缩进、空格、换行等。#### 2. 格式化选中代码 (Format Selection)
功能:
仅格式化选中的代码片段,适合局部调整代码格式。
操作:
快捷键: `Ctrl + K, Ctrl + F` (Windows) 或 `Cmd + K, Cmd + F` (macOS)
菜单栏: `选择 / 代码 / 格式化选择`
右键菜单: `格式化选择`#### 3. 使用代码格式化扩展插件
功能:
VSCode 支持丰富的扩展插件,可以针对不同编程语言提供更加专业的代码格式化功能。例如:
Prettier:
支持 JavaScript、TypeScript、HTML、CSS 等多种语言。
Beautify:
支持 JavaScript、JSON、CSS、Sass 和 HTML。
ESLint:
针对 JavaScript 代码的语法检查和代码风格规范。
安装:
在 VSCode 扩展商店中搜索并安装需要的插件。
使用:
安装插件后,通常会自动应用于对应类型的文件,也可以通过配置文件进行个性化设置。### 内容详细说明#### 1. 配置格式化选项VSCode 的代码格式化功能高度可定制,用户可以通过 `settings.json` 文件来自定义格式化选项。 例如,可以设置缩进方式、空格数量、换行规则等。以下是几个常用的格式化选项:
`editor.insertSpaces`: 控制缩进使用空格还是制表符。
`editor.tabSize`: 设置一个制表符等于多少个空格。
`editor.formatOnSave`: 设置保存文件时自动格式化。
`[languageId].format.enable`: 针对特定语言启用或禁用格式化功能,例如 `"javascript.format.enable": true`。用户可以根据自己的代码风格偏好进行个性化配置,以满足不同的项目需求。#### 2. 利用格式化快捷键提高效率熟练掌握格式化快捷键可以显著提升代码整理效率。建议将 `格式化文档` 和 `格式化选择` 的快捷键绑定到方便操作的位置,以便快速整理代码。#### 3. 善用代码格式化扩展插件针对不同编程语言,选择合适的代码格式化扩展插件可以更好地满足代码风格规范和个人偏好。例如,Prettier 插件可以帮助开发者轻松地将代码格式化为统一的风格,并支持多种编辑器和 IDE,方便团队协作。### 总结VSCode 提供了强大的代码整理功能,可以帮助开发者轻松告别凌乱代码,提高代码质量和开发效率。建议开发者根据自身需求,灵活运用 VSCode 的代码格式化功能和相关扩展插件,打造高效舒适的编码环境。
VSCode 整理代码: 轻松告别凌乱代码
简介代码整洁是优秀程序员的基本素养。整洁的代码不仅赏心悦目,更能提升代码可读性和可维护性,减少潜在 bug。而 VSCode 作为一个强大的代码编辑器,提供了丰富的代码整理功能,帮助我们轻松告别凌乱代码,提高开发效率。
VSCode 代码整理功能VSCode 提供了多种方式来整理代码,主要包括以下几种:
1. 格式化文档 (Format Document)**功能:** 根据预设的代码风格规范自动格式化整个文档。**操作:*** 快捷键: `Shift + Alt + F` (Windows) 或 `Shift + Option + F` (macOS) * 菜单栏: `选择 / 代码 / 格式化文档` * 右键菜单: `格式化文档`**配置:** 格式化样式可以通过设置进行个性化配置,例如缩进、空格、换行等。
2. 格式化选中代码 (Format Selection)**功能:** 仅格式化选中的代码片段,适合局部调整代码格式。**操作:*** 快捷键: `Ctrl + K, Ctrl + F` (Windows) 或 `Cmd + K, Cmd + F` (macOS) * 菜单栏: `选择 / 代码 / 格式化选择` * 右键菜单: `格式化选择`
3. 使用代码格式化扩展插件**功能:** VSCode 支持丰富的扩展插件,可以针对不同编程语言提供更加专业的代码格式化功能。例如:* **Prettier:** 支持 JavaScript、TypeScript、HTML、CSS 等多种语言。 * **Beautify:** 支持 JavaScript、JSON、CSS、Sass 和 HTML。 * **ESLint:** 针对 JavaScript 代码的语法检查和代码风格规范。**安装:** 在 VSCode 扩展商店中搜索并安装需要的插件。**使用:** 安装插件后,通常会自动应用于对应类型的文件,也可以通过配置文件进行个性化设置。
内容详细说明
1. 配置格式化选项VSCode 的代码格式化功能高度可定制,用户可以通过 `settings.json` 文件来自定义格式化选项。 例如,可以设置缩进方式、空格数量、换行规则等。以下是几个常用的格式化选项:* `editor.insertSpaces`: 控制缩进使用空格还是制表符。* `editor.tabSize`: 设置一个制表符等于多少个空格。* `editor.formatOnSave`: 设置保存文件时自动格式化。* `[languageId].format.enable`: 针对特定语言启用或禁用格式化功能,例如 `"javascript.format.enable": true`。用户可以根据自己的代码风格偏好进行个性化配置,以满足不同的项目需求。
2. 利用格式化快捷键提高效率熟练掌握格式化快捷键可以显著提升代码整理效率。建议将 `格式化文档` 和 `格式化选择` 的快捷键绑定到方便操作的位置,以便快速整理代码。
3. 善用代码格式化扩展插件针对不同编程语言,选择合适的代码格式化扩展插件可以更好地满足代码风格规范和个人偏好。例如,Prettier 插件可以帮助开发者轻松地将代码格式化为统一的风格,并支持多种编辑器和 IDE,方便团队协作。
总结VSCode 提供了强大的代码整理功能,可以帮助开发者轻松告别凌乱代码,提高代码质量和开发效率。建议开发者根据自身需求,灵活运用 VSCode 的代码格式化功能和相关扩展插件,打造高效舒适的编码环境。